The Licensing Fight: Your First Round Defence

Think of a casino license like a boxing referee. A bad referee lets the fight get dirty. A good one stops the clinch and enforces the rules. For UK players, the only referee you should trust is the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). Full stop. If a site is not UKGC licensed, do not even look at it. It’s like stepping into a ring with no gloves.

When I check a site for the best Brighton casino UK 2026 top sites to play, the first thing I do is scroll to the footer. I look for the UKGC logo and the license number. Then I cross-check that number on the UKGC official website. I have caught three fake licenses this year alone. Don’t be lazy. Do it.

Here is a quick checklist I use:

  • License from UKGC? (Not Curacao, not Malta for UK players).
  • SSL encryption? (Look for the padlock in the URL bar).
  • Clear ownership? (Who owns the brand? Betway? 888? A shell company?).

I once found a site claiming to be the best in Brighton. It had a beautiful design. But the license was expired. I reported them. Don’t be a victim.

Bonus Terms: The Dirty Clinch

Bonuses are the most dangerous part of online gambling. They look like a gift, but they are often a trap. It’s like a boxer who offers you a handshake but tries to pull you into a headlock. The best Brighton casino UK 2026 top sites to play will have fair terms, but you still need to read the fine print.

Let me give you a real example from a site I recently reviewed. They offered a 100% match bonus up to £200. Sounds great, right? But the wagering was 45x on the bonus plus the deposit. That means you have to bet through £9,000 to release £200. That is a sucker bet. I walked away.

Look for these specific numbers in the T&Cs:

  • Wagering requirement: Should be 35x or lower on bonus only (not bonus+deposit).
  • Game contributions: Slots count 100%. Blackjack might only count 10% or 0%.
  • Max bet while wagering: Usually £5 per spin. Some rogue sites try to limit you to £2.
  • Time limit: 30 days is standard. 7 days is a scam. Run.

I also check for the “max cashout” clause. Some sites cap your winnings from a bonus at £100. So even if you win £1,000, you only get £100. That is legal, but it is predatory. Avoid those sites.

Game Fairness: Are the Dice Loaded?

I am paranoid about RNGs (Random Number Generators). I need proof that the games are fair. The best Brighton casino UK 2026 top sites to play will have their games audited by independent labs like eCOGRA or iTech Labs. Look for the seal of approval on the site.

If a site doesn’t show an audit report, I assume the games are rigged. It’s that simple. You wouldn’t play poker with someone who brings their own deck of cards. Don’t gamble on a site that won’t show you the proof.

Some sites even offer “provably fair” games, which let you verify the outcome yourself. That is the gold standard. But for UK slots, just look for the eCOGRA logo. It’s not a guarantee, but it’s a good sign.

Payment Methods: Getting Your Money Out

This is where the fight gets real. A casino can be beautiful, licensed, and fair, but if it takes 10 days to process a withdrawal, it’s useless. I test the withdrawal process on every site I review. I deposit £10, play a few spins, and then request a withdrawal. If it’s not in my bank within 48 hours, I blacklist the site.

For UK players, the best methods are PayPal, Skrill, Neteller, and debit cards (Visa/Mastercard). Some sites now accept Apple Pay or Google Pay, which is fast. But avoid bank transfers if you want speed.

Here is a table of typical withdrawal times for the top sites I found in June 2026:

Payment Method Typical Withdrawal Time Minimum Withdrawal
PayPal Under 2 hours £10
Debit Card (Visa) 1-3 business days £10
Skrill/Neteller Under 1 hour £10
Bank Transfer 3-5 business days £20

I personally prefer PayPal. It’s instant and I don’t have to share my bank details with the casino. But always check the casino’s withdrawal policy for their specific limits.

Are there any specific T&Cs I should look for?

Yes. Look for the “Maximum Bet” clause during wagering. If it’s £2 per spin, the bonus is basically useless. Also look for “Game Weighting” – some slots are excluded from wagering entirely.

How do I know a site is secure?

Check the URL. It must start with ‘https://’. Also check the SSL certificate by clicking the padlock icon. If it’s expired, do not enter your card details.

What is the best way to deposit for a bonus?

Use a debit card or PayPal. Some e-wallets like Skrill are excluded from certain bonus offers. Always read the promo terms to see if your payment method is eligible.

Responsible Gambling: The Only Real Win

I have to say this. Gambling is not a way to make money. It is entertainment. The house always wins in the long run. The best Brighton casino UK 2026 top sites to play will have responsible gambling tools like deposit limits, time-outs, and self-exclusion. Use them.

I set a deposit limit of £50 per week. I also use the “reality check” feature that reminds me how long I have been playing. If you feel like you are chasing losses, stop. Walk away. The casino will still be there tomorrow. Your bank account might not be.

There are organisations like GamCare and BeGambleAware that offer free support. Use them if you need to. There is no shame in asking for help. I almost got addicted after my first big win. It is a slippery slope.
